Why it's listed
The French Laundry is Thomas Keller's three-Michelin-star Yountville flagship, a daily-changing tasting menu of French and American haute cuisine. Its current Chef's Tasting Menu offers Japanese Miyazaki Wagyu as an optional main-course substitution (a $135 supplement), plated with elephant garlic pudding, egg-yolk gnocchi, chanterelles and a bearnaise gastrique. The Wagyu is prefecture-disclosed (Miyazaki) but appears as a single supplement rather than a standing Wagyu program, and the menu turns over daily.
